(1) Intensity of diffraction fringes decreases as the order (n) increases
In the diffraction pattern of single slit, there are maxima at θ ≈ (n + 1/2) λ/a . Intensity is decreasing with increasing n.
Let us consider an angle θ = 3λ/2a which is midway between two of the dark fringes. Let us Divide the slit into three equal parts.
If we take the first two thirds of the slit, the path difference between the two ends would be
The first two-thirds of the slit can therefore be divided into two halves which have a path difference λ.
The contributions of these two halves cancel . Only the remaining one-third of the slit contributes to the intensity at a point between
the two minima. This will be much weaker than the central maximum (where the entire slit contributes in phase). One
can similarly show that there are maxima at (n + 1/2) θ/a with n = 2, 3, etc. These become weaker with increasing n,
since only one-fifth, one-seventh, etc., of the slit contributes in these cases.

(2) angular width of central maxima is twice that of the first order secondary maxima
First Dark fringe is occuring when path difference is λ. Hence angular width of central maxima = λa , where a is slit width.
Second dark fring is occuring when path difference is 2λ. Hence angular width of first order secondary maxima = 2λa
